Salmon, Mango and Curry Quinoa Bowl
Prep Time15 Minutes
Servings2
Cook Time20 Minutes
Calories804
Ingredients
1 cup light coconut milk
1 cup low-sodium chicken stock
1 tbs curry powder
1 tsp honey
1 cup quinoa, rinsed
2 cups baby spinach
2 (6-ounce) skin-on salmon fillets
1/2 tsp kosher salt
1 tbs grapeseed or canola oil
1 large mango (about 1 cup), diced
1 cup red cabbage, shredded
1/2 cup cucumber, peeled and diced
1 tbs cilantro, chopped
1 tbs fresh basil, chopped
2 lime wedges (optional)
Directions

In a medium pot, bring coconut milk, stock, curry powder and honey to a boil. Once boiling, add quinoa and cover.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 15 to 20 minutes, until most of the liquid has absorbed. Add spinach; stir and cover. Allow to sit for 5 minutes. Season the salmon with salt. Heat oil over medium-high heat in a skillet. Once the oil is hot, place salmon skin-side down and cook for 4 minutes, until skin is golden and crisp. Flip salmon and cook for an additional 3 minutes, until the salmon is cooked to your liking and flakes easily with a fork. Divide quinoa between two plates and top with salmon, mango, cabbage, cucumber, cilantro, basil and a squeeze of lime juice if desired.

 

Nutritional Information
  • 51 g Protein
  • 80 g Carbohydrates
  • 31 g Fat
